WiFi Tools & Troubleshooting Seminar
July 26th, 2012 – Edmonton, AB
This WiFi Tools and Troubleshooting Seminar will
provide the attendees a detailed view of the Fluke
Networks AirMagnet WiFi product line and highlight
how to address WiFi challenges by using the latest
tools and troubleshooting techniques.
Seminar highlights:
Troubleshooting and verification
using the AirCheck WiFi tester
rr
Plan and deploy a/b/g/n wireless networks using the AirMagnet Planner
Design and deploy wireless LANs for optimal performance, security and
compliance using the AirMagnet Survey
Proactively identify and find sources of RF interferences using the AirMagnet
Spectrum XT
Tony will also include interesting information about 802.11 fundamentals, WiFi network
design, WiFi today, top complaints regarding WLAN networks and WLAN lifecycle tools
